Hi, taking over from Marisol before she moves to the Larkfield team. Pennon is our feature-flag rollout framework; it evaluates cohort rules server-side and syncs flag state to edge caches every thirty seconds. The pending review covers the new percentage-ramp evaluator, which replaces the legacy bucket hasher. Please check the ramp boundary math carefully — off-by-one errors here leak flags to the wrong cohort. To reproduce my test runs, use the staging evaluator with the exact settings I used, listed here.

service settings:
[casax]
port = 6379
team = rusir
host = casax.zemvarhq.corp
region = outer-4
access_code = ac_9808ce
timeout_ms = 1500

Action item from the Glowpine OTA incident: stop hardcoding rollout pacing in the updater. We pushed a bad wave to 40% of kettles before anyone blinked. Future maintainers — pacing, halt thresholds, and retry backoff now live in one config block. Please don't scatter them again. The agreed defaults are below.

constants for bagug-kagap:
CAPS = {
    "tamwyn": 283,
    "zorys": 811,
    "oliir": 695,
}

Internal Memo — Budget Request

To the sales leads: Operations has submitted a budget request to fund two additional demo kits for the Vellane product line and travel support for the Ashgrove territory push. Finance expects a decision within two weeks. No changes to current spending limits until then; log any urgent needs with your regional coordinator. Background on the request's purpose appears below.

board note of fahaf-fadug: Gilixax Logistics is in early talks to buy Praiusax Partners for about $8.1 million. The Pramir launch date is September 23, and nothing goes to the press before then.

## Fee Rules Engine — Quick Notes

For the sync: Cartwheel's shipping-fee rules engine reloads its ruleset every five minutes, so hotfixes to `fees.yaml` land fast. If fees look wrong, check `FEEGINE_RULESET_VERSION` in the env file first. Rollback is just pinning the prior version. The pricing service token goes on the env file line right after this.

env line for fafof-fahag: LEDGER_TOKEN5=f8790